Plane Crashes Into West Texas TV Tower

  Thursday, February 5th, 2015 Source: KDFW

One man is dead after the small aircraft he was flying crashed into a TV tower as he approached an airport in West Texas. Emergency workers searched late Wednesday near the KCBD-TV tower in Lubbock for any other victims. Lubbock police said Thursday that the pilot was alone. The Federal Aviation Administration reports the single-engine Piper PA-46 crashed into the 814-foot tower while approaching Preston Smith International Airport on a flight from Carlsbad, New Mexico. FAA spokesman Lynn Lunsford said the aircraft dropped off radar around 7:30 p.m.
